A History of Clockwork
The story of clockwork begins with ancient societies, though the primitive devices weren't precisely the intricate mechanisms we understand today. Simple hydraulic power, employed by the Romans, drove early automata – automated figures and toys – demonstrating the possibility of controlled movement. The Late Ages saw important advancements with the emergence of geared systems, largely powered by the need for reliable timekeeping. The fourteenth century witnessed the birth of the earliest true mechanical clocks in Europe, marking a turning moment. From the rebirth onward, clockwork became an art form, generating increasingly elaborate toys, astronomical devices , and even mechanical marvels that demonstrated the ingenuity of engineers. The 18th and 1800s centuries solidified clockwork’s position in both scientific innovation and popular entertainment .
Repairing Clockwork Devices
Repairing vintage automated devices requires expertise and perseverance . The process typically involves taking apart the complex machine to identify the source of the problem . Frequent issues include damaged springs , stuck gears , and clogged movement. Fine tools , such as miniature screwdrivers and pincers, are necessary for this sensitive task . After cleaning the parts , changing of broken pieces may be required , often obtaining them from niche dealers. Finally, methodical reassembling and testing are crucial to confirm the check here mechanism’s proper function .
